The main objective of this project is to characterize and understand the liquefying process on Tal R paintings using mainly spectroscopic techniques at CATS – SMK. The results will be compared to materials from the artist’s studio potentially used by Tal R on those paintings, as well as materials from a non-dripping artwork from the same period and artist. The identification of those materials will contribute to a better understanding of the degradation process as well as to better design conservation and exhibition strategies.
